Property Amenities
Hotel Granvia Osaka features a variety of dining venues including a café/lounge in the lobby and 5 restaurants, a bar, and 2 lounges on the 19th floor. Event facilities include 10 conference rooms and banquet facilities. This hotel also offers multilingual staff at the 24-hour front desk and concierge desk. Complimentary newspapers are available in the lobby. Parking is available for a surcharge.
Rooms
The 648 air-conditioned guestrooms at Hotel Granvia Osaka include satellite television with pay movies and complimentary high-speed (wired) Internet access. Rooms also offer direct-dial phones with voice mail and complimentary newspapers.
Coffee/tea makers and minibars are provided. Bathrooms feature shower/tub combinations with handheld showerheads, makeup/shaving mirrors, and complimentary toiletries. Guests are provided with yukatas and slippers.

Dining
Fleuve - French and Italian cuisine served in casual setting. Open for breakfast, lunch, and dinner.
Kiryu - Grilled meat, seafood, and seasonal vegetables are prepared in front of guests at this teppan-yaki restaurant. Open for lunch and dinner.
Ukihashi - A formal Japanese restaurant serving breakfast, lunch, and dinner.
Shizuku - A casual Japanese restaurant open for lunch and dinner.
ab - Buffet-style lunch and dessert and a la cart dinner served in this pub and restaurant.
Peking - Chinese cuisine is served for lunch and dinner.

Area:
Umeda, Osaka, Japan: Located in the cityÂ’s north side, this is OsakaÂ’s center for contemporary shopping. In addition to numerous shopping malls, this is the home of the Umeda Sky Building. Designed to reflect the image of the sky, the buildingÂ’s two 173 meter towers are joined by exterior escalators and a rooftop floating garden. The Blue Note Osaka, one of the cityÂ’s premier jazz clubs, is also found in Umeda.
